Output 076cfe5f13cb30e3998d8fc9c03408cc94179dbfa860511d903c2abb049a79c5:1

value
589696
script pubkey
OP_0 OP_PUSHBYTES_20 8574bcf108a9fb0a4a8ee0183aa21eaf754e7ac3
address
ltc1qs46teugg48as5j5wuqvr4gs74a65u7kr5afjuk
transaction
076cfe5f13cb30e3998d8fc9c03408cc94179dbfa860511d903c2abb049a79c5
spent
true